JANUARY 1981

CONFERENCE OF CARIBBEAN OAGS:

ITEM 7: FUTURE STAFFING OF THE DEPENDENT TERRITORIES

POINTS TO MAKE

1. Of the six OAGS present, only two of you have spent your

entire careers in HMOCS. The other four are DS officers, of whom

two have HMOCS experience. The pattern of a shrinking HMOCS and

greater reliance on DS is likely to continue apace in the future.

2. Need to take early steps to prepare DS for filling posts in

the dependent territories. DS officers with HMOCS experience are

also thinning out. We will have consciously to prepare more

people for the job.

3. Against this background, the paper circulated has been con-

sidered and provisionally agreed by senior officials in the FCO.

4. An essential element in the proposals is the need to use

existing HMOCS talent wherever possible up to or just beyond the

normal retirement age.

5. Welcome comments on them and any supplementary suggestions.
